Now couple more things about this Pentecost is called feast of weeks.

It's called feast of weeks for an important reason from the day of firstfruits. It was 77, the day after the seven sevens know what I mean by that seven is an important biblical number. It was seven weeks 49 days 7×7 and it was the day after that which was the 50th day, so 50 days after the day of firstfruits was the day of Pentecost. And so that put it on Sunday. Now it's interesting because one of the things that happened on at the feast of weeks was instead of just unleavened bread like was used in every other feast.

There were two loads there was a unleavened loaf and there was a leavened love Mount 11 picture of sin also can be used is buses Gentiles. It did not know God, that were separated by our sin, not even looking for God, combined into the church and that's what you see begin to happen at the feast of Pentecost asking to be a few chapters before it goes out into the world now so now 50 days later everybody is back in Jerusalem and the Lord picks that time for this occurrence that what is suggested and what possible personal relevance could it have for you today about the life lesson here. Then they were all amazed and marveled, saying to one another look, are not all these who speak Galileans Galileans primarily spoke Hebrew and Aramaic. Very few knew Greek in verse eight, and how is it that we hear, each in our own language in which we were born. Now this tells us that what they were speaking in was a known language to some of the listeners, but it was not a known language to the person that was speaking working again will get more into this known and unknown and whatnot's continual verse not Parthians and Medes in our minds those dwelling in Mesopotamia, Judea, and C of Pontus, Asia, Phrygia and Pamphylia, Egypt and the parts of Libya adjoining soldering visitors from Rome, both Jews and proselytes Cretans and Arabs we hear them speaking in our own tongues the wonderful works of God, the Lord gathered these Jewish people who had been disbursed.

Some of them probably going back to the Assyrian and Babylonian captivity never came back to Jerusalem and and often you'll hear the word diaspora, which means disbursed the dispersing of the Jews.

Usually they were dispersed all over the world. But for this feast. They came back to Jerusalem. Why was that important to God. Strategic planning strategic planning is a strategic planner. He has wisdom 15 nations represented there in Jerusalem. Seeing what was going on getting ready to hear the gospel revolve about the breakout. Guess who's going to take it to the world.
